NOTE: The object used in this system check can be fabricated using a 9 cm diameter (3 in I.D.) pipe, 100 cm (39 in) in length (available as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C) pipe, or similar from a hardware or plumbing supply.NOTE: The following system check should be carried out with the vehicle on a level surface.NOTE: Actual sensor arrangement may differ from the configuration shown.
Distribute the test objects evenly across the bumper as shown. Refer to the specifications in this information.
- Turn the ignition switch to the ON position, engine off.
- Apply the parking brake.
- Select REVERSE (R) for rear parking aid.
- Select DRIVE (D) for front parking aid.
-
NOTE: The speaker should beep slowly when objects are detected on the outer edges of the detection zone, and increase in rate as the object is moved closer to the vehicle. When the object is within 12in (30cm) of the bumper, the tone should sound continuously.NOTE: If the PAM does not detect the object above, refer to Diagnosis and Testing.
Verify that the PAM detects the objects when placed in the specified locations (P1, P2, P3, P4 and P5).
